Live Oak County, TX offer from Southwest Petroleum

i recently received an offer from SW Petroleum to buy my mineral rights in Live Oak County Texas. I occassionally receive these kind of offers from various oil companies, etc. I am just trying to get some feedback as to these kind of offers. Are they legit? Are the offers ever decent or should they just be ignored? Thanks!

Timothy:

There are many firms trying to buy existing minerals and yes, I think most are legit but they are most likely offering thousands less than the minerals would be worth. First, I would never ever sell mineral rights as one day these could possibly become a good or great extra income. Second, I have found that these firms zero in on the "hot" areas where they know production history is very good. Finally, I have also recieved offers over the past several years and they all end up in the waste basket.

Timothy:

I would contact other mineral owners in your area in order get an idea about what the going rate per acre. Also, you can shop around and find out who is acitively leasing in the area and contact each company. I am not familiar with that area but the % royalty in my areas are now about 16 to 20%. Also, remember to be aware the length of the lease. I am not signing for more than 3 years.
